Surah Al Haqqah Info
Intro
Name: Surah Al-Haqqah
Meaning: The Inevitable
Period of Revelation
Al-Haqqah Surah was revealed in Makkah consists of 52 Ayat 2 Raku and 69th chapter of Holy (29th) Para.

2. It has been narrated on the authority of Anas bin Malik who said:
On the Day of Uhud, some of the defeated people left the Prophet (PBUH), but Abu Talha stood before him, covering him with a shield. Abu Talha was a mighty archer who broke two or three bows that day. When a man would pass by carrying a quiver containing arrows, he would say: Spare them for Abu Talha. Whenever the Prophet (PBUH) raised his head to look at the people, Abu Talha would say: Prophet of Allah, may my father and my mother be thy ransom, do not raise your head lest an arrow shot by the enemy strike you. My neck is before your neck. The narrator said: I saw Ayesha bint Abu Bakr and Umm e Sulaim. Both of them had tucked up their garments so that I could see the anklets on their feet. They were carrying water-skins on their backs and would pour water into the mouths of the people. They would then go back (to the well), fill them again, and return to pour water into the mouths of the soldiers. (On this day), Abu Talha’s sword dropped down from his hands twice or thrice because of drowsiness.
(Sahih Muslim: 1811)

4. It was narrated from Abu Musa Al-Ashari that the Messenger of Allah (PBUH) said:
“The people will be presented (before Allah) three times on the Day of Resurrection. The first two times will be for disputes and excuses, and the third time will be when the scrolls (of deeds) fly into their hands; some will take it in the right hand and some in the left.
(Sunan Ibn Majah: 4277)
Conclusion
The judgment of Allah will infallibly come. Nation Aad, Thamud, and Pharaoh were destroyed for rejecting their prophets. As the flood came, so shall the judgment certainly come. On judgment day, Allah’s throne shall be borne by eight mighty angels. The good and bad shall receive their account-books and be judged according to their deeds
